What a “lifetime” shingle guaranty incredibly covers
Manufacturers use “confined lifetime” to describe the materials guarantee on architectural asphalt shingles. Lifetime does not mean what it means in informal speech. It almost always capacity the envisioned existence of the product for a unmarried proprietor, with proration after an initial non prorated era. On many lines, the non prorated time period stages from 10 to 15 years. During that early window, if the shingles have a manufacturing defect, the drapery cost is included at 100 p.c and, on some tiers, a collection amount of exertions might be covered. After that, the price of the declare decreases both yr.
Wind and algae warranties are their own line gadgets. A universal wind rating is 110 to one hundred thirty mph, every now and then upgradeable to one hundred fifty mph while the complete accessory process and one of a kind installation techniques are used. In Glastonbury, titanic wind complaints regularly stick with nor’easters, and I actually have obvious ridge caps cross on Minnechaug rooftops that were flawlessly great in different places on the similar block. Algae warranties ordinarilly run 10 to twenty-five years and conceal the unpleasant black streaking that exhibits up on north-facing slopes near tall maples, such as you in finding along House Street or via Addison Park.
The workmanship assurance comes from the roofing contractor, no longer the brand, until you purchase a registered gadget guaranty that wraps labor and supplies under a unmarried company umbrella. Good workmanship warranties run 5 to 15 years from a reputable roofing organisation. The top tier producer components warranties upload longer workmanship insurance plan, from time to time 25 years, equipped the installer is licensed and each special component is used.
Three layers of coverage and the way they stack
Think of shingle roofing warranties in 3 stacked layers:
Manufacturer subject matter warranty. This addresses production defects in shingles and branded equipment. If a batch of shingles has excessive granule loss or premature cracking, that is wherein relief comes from. It does now not quilt storm smash, foot visitors, or improper install.
Installer workmanship guarantee. This addresses how the roof was put on. If a ridge vent is lower too large, a flashing lap is reversed, or nails are top, the workmanship warranty deserve to maintain the correction. It does now not quilt a unhealthy product.
Registered technique guarantee. This is a step that ties the roof collectively. If you use the shingle emblem’s underlayment, starter, hip and ridge, and feature an authorized roofing contractor install and register the activity, the enterprise may grant broader insurance plan that incorporates labor for accredited defects. It will nonetheless exclude typhoon pursuits and home owner forget about, but it could actually fill the hard work hole that surprises of us all the way through drapery-handiest claims.
On a roof in the Buckingham Historic District, a home-owner had a leak 3 winters in a row. The shingles have been nice. The quandary changed into an underlayment gap at a roof-to-wall transition, hidden underneath a tall snow waft. The corporation material warranty did nothing for them. The installer’s workmanship assurance, a ten year promise, blanketed the fix and a contemporary counterflashing element. That is the change among product and perform.
Why Connecticut weather pushes the positive print to the front
Shingle warranties are written for the continent, but weather in Hartford County presses categorical clauses. Ice dam destroy is a colossal one. Water infiltrating below shingles because of ice dams is just not a shingle defect, so maximum textile warranties do now not duvet it. Some method warranties add limited coverage if ice and water barrier turned into put in to code, which in Connecticut method at least as much as 24 inches within the outside wall line. Steeper roofs in South Glastonbury shed snow turbo, however the long valley sections I see close to Glastonbury High School and over by using the ferry landing to Rocky Hill acquire snow that melts and refreezes, testing each element. A properly ice and water membrane and ventilation usually are not good to have, they are foundational to claim achievement.
Wind coverage additionally interacts with deploy particulars. To obtain the posted wind rating, shingles require the true nail count number inside the brand’s nail region, correct deck fastening, and sealed starter strips at eaves and rakes. A homeowner in Minnechaug had shingles blown to come back along a rake after a March hurricane. The drapery changed into exceptional. The rake aspect lacked a sealed starter, so the wind assurance did now not practice. The installer returned and corrected it below their workmanship policy.
Algae stains are any other Connecticut general. You can nonetheless see older neighborhoods round Glastonbury Center with patchy black streaks. Today’s shingles with copper-containing granules resist algae increase for a defined interval. The algae assurance probably covers cleaning or subject material replacement if streaks manifest sooner than the time period ends, but most effective if the roof meets slope and shade parameters and the declare is submitted with transparent evidence. If you live lower than the all right off Chestnut Hill Road, mood expectations. Heavy, continuous coloration reduces airflow and might speed up staining. That is an look dilemma, now not a leak, and it lives in a separate warranty lane.
Common exclusions you may want to are expecting to see
Warranty documents overlap, yet a few exclusions are standard for shingle roofing:
- Storm ruin and acts of God are not textile defects. Hail, wind beyond the rating, and flying particles from a nor’easter fall below house owners insurance, now not the shingle warranty. Improper setting up voids policy cover. High nailing, less than-driven nails, missing starter, negative deck condition, insufficient air flow, and flashing error will shift liability to workmanship or go away you with a denial. Ventilation noncompliance can void equally textile and approach warranties. Manufacturers have minimum web free ventilation requirements. If you change a roof on a dwelling near the Welles-Turner Memorial Library and maintain ornamental gable vents however no ridge or soffit vents, you can seize warm and moisture, cook your shingles, and erase upkeep. Non-equipment aspects can decrease protection. Mixing underlayment brands or skipping branded equipment puts you in a cloth-only bucket even supposing the shingle itself is top rate. Unapproved upkeep or overlays complicate claims. A moment roof layer or a patch mounted with the wrong shingle line can reduce or void policy cover.
What “transferable” certainly does for resale
Glastonbury properties carry fee, rather in neighborhoods with walkability to Glastonbury Center or proximity to Riverfront Park. A transferable shingle guaranty can assist a listing stand out, yet comprehend the mechanics. Most confined lifetime warranties permit a single move to the following owner inside a group time, ordinarilly 10 years from the normal install. After switch, the policy cover also can end up time constrained for the hot proprietor, for example 40 or 50 years general with proration. Some system warranties require a small transfer fee and a professional letter inside of 60 days of ultimate. I endorse agents to stay the fashioned registration electronic mail and a copy of the paid bill on hand. Buyers deserve to ask for the roofing organisation’s ultimate inspection photos and the enable closeout from the metropolis. These small packets close guarantee gaps sooner than they open.
How claims virtually get approved
The quickest approvals come from refreshing documentation. When I file on behalf of a house owner, I post the original agreement, the registration certificate for any method warranty, photos that convey the circumstance throughout distinct slopes, a close-up of the alleged illness, and the attic shots demonstrating ventilation and underlayment where imperative. I date stamp pics after noticeable weather movements, especially when I get texts from valued clientele in Buckingham or alongside Hopewell Road approximately shingle carry. If wind created the concern, I direct them to their insurance coverage service and I consciousness the assurance channel on manufacturing unit issues simply.
Expect website online inspections. Manufacturers or their reps repeatedly send an inspector, specifically for super claims. They will inspect nailing, deck circumstance, and air flow. This is in which a good roofing contractor with a disciplined setting up task pays dividends. The task may want to meet company requisites lengthy after the team trucks roll away.

A short glossary for interpreting guaranty language
- Limited lifetime: protection for the unique proprietor’s occupancy with proration after an preliminary non prorated era. Prorated period: the insurance price decreases with time, more often than not after 12 months 10 or 15. Non prorated era: the early window whilst the company pays full materials significance and many times labor. Algae warranty: assurance for discoloration from blue-efficient algae progress, now not for leaks. Wind warranty: coverage for shingle blow off up to a rated pace, contingent on setting up assembly specific standards.
Real examples from Glastonbury jobs
A South Glastonbury cape with a ten:12 entrance slope had positive shingles however suffered habitual leaks near a masonry chimney at some point of freeze-thaw cycles. The installer had reused outdated step flashing. The home-owner phoned after a stained ceiling seemed in January. We documented the situation, mentioned the mistaken flashing, and activated the workmanship assurance. New step and counterflashing solved it, and the organization assurance remained intact.
A cut up point close to the ferry had early granule loss at year seven, seen in the gutters as copper coloured grit. We set a tarp on a sunny day and took macro pics. The inspector located a production anomaly throughout a particular creation run. The cloth guaranty lined new shingles and a labor allowance simply because the declare fell throughout the non prorated window. The home owner paid for upgraded ice and water policy cover at the eaves in the course of the reroof, which is a good add while a brand is footing such a lot of the bill.
A dwelling house by means of Addison Park saw shingle carry alongside a north rake after a spring typhoon. The shingles were put in to spec, starter strip became sealed, and nails were inside the quarter. The wind gusts passed the assurance rating elegant on National Weather Service info for that telephone. We moved the declare to the owner of a house’s insurance plan. The roofing business enterprise taken care of the emergency dry in and the insurer picked up the leisure.

Registration and office work most owners forget
Registration isn't automated. For many brands, a familiar cloth guaranty prompts devoid of registration, however superior and technique warranties require on line submission inside a collection number of days after roof deploy. I actually have observed important roofs in Glastonbury leave out out on multiplied hard work protection with ease given that the registration model in no way left the place of business. Ask your roofing contractor for a copy of the registration confirmation e-mail and retain it together with your ultimate information or inside the cloud for easy get entry to. If you're making use of a professional installer to qualify for a upper tier procedure assurance, they ought to post the task with an appropriate accessory checklist. Swapping in an unbranded ridge vent to keep some money can kneecap the total kit.
Keep preservation logs. Warranty terms most often require the roof be stored free of particles and that gutters stay practical. After fall leaf drop along streets shaded via the Meshomasic State Forest side, clogged gutters can again water below eaves, stain fascia, and begin ice dams. A dated notice or electronic mail to yourself with a rapid snapshot of cleared gutters every single fall and spring builds a paper trail that facilitates in a dispute.
The roof deck and ventilation question that comes to a decision claims
Manufacturers quietly preserve all cards with air flow. They specify minimum net unfastened space, cut up among intake at soffits and exhaust at the ridge or simply by excessive vents. Attic inspections in older houses close Buckingham usually expose blocked soffits choked with insulation from a Nineteen Nineties energy push. If your attic lacks non-stop intake, shingles can run hotter, curl faster, and lose granules sooner. When an inspector sticks a thermometer probe by using your entry hatch in July and files 140 levels, the documents begins leaning against you.
Have your roofing manufacturer calculate required consumption and exhaust by using sq. pictures, then photograph the open soffits, set up baffles, and ridge vent. In one Glastonbury Center cape, we introduced sensible, low profile spherical intake vents in the frieze the place unique soffits were too narrow, then lower a continual ridge vent. The home-owner received a legitimate guaranty, cooler summer time bedrooms, and fewer ice dam troubles the subsequent wintry weather.
When covering shingles hurts more than it helps
Local building code makes it possible for a 2nd shingle layer in some instances, yet guaranty force regularly falls whenever you go that course. Overlays trap heat, cover deck things, and make right nailing more demanding. Manufacturers more commonly slash policy cover or deny stronger warranties for overlays. In Glastonbury’s climate, the more effective cross is a complete tear off. You get a smooth deck to investigate cross-check, a possibility to exchange questionable sheathing, and also you qualify for the higher end method warranties. The marginal savings of an overlay hardly ever rise up to a denied declare five years later whilst a mushy deck gives underfoot near a valley.

A be aware on roofing upload ons and the way they affect coverage
Solar panels are spreading throughout roofs close to Glastonbury High and on cul-de-sacs towards Hopewell. Panel attachments penetrate the roof masking, that means your installer will have to flash both stanchion accurately. If you propose for solar in the time of a roof replacement, ask the roofing contractor to coordinate with the sun group’s layout. Some manufacturers supply accent flashings designed to safeguard assurance compliance. Skylights are related. Reusing an old skylight to shop a few hundred dollars can punch a gap in the two your comfort and your guaranty stance if the seal fails next year. Replacing skylights at some point of re-roofing is the realistic, warranty pleasant cross.
What to do when you just bought a dwelling house with a “new roof”
I stroll into lately purchased buildings, recurrently near Glastonbury Center or Buckingham, and find a brand new roof without documents. You can nevertheless construct a report. Call the the city for the enable report, which lists the roofing contractor. Ask the vendor’s agent for the bill. Reach out to the installer for any guaranty registrations and the workmanship guarantee document. If they by no means registered a method assurance, you may well be external the window so as to add it, but you will nonetheless report contemporary situations. Have a trusted roof craftsman picture the attic, soffits, and ridge, clear any debris, and song up flashing around chimneys and sidewalls. This low can charge baseline is the cheapest coverage you can actually buy.
